2016-12-28 27 views
1

作爲一個新鮮的Django,我正在嘗試製作一個Django應用程序,它將從用戶處獲取姓名和出生日期,並向用戶發送生日提醒。如何在django應用程序中連續檢查當前時間?

現在我已經爲它設置模型,但我被困在如何檢查當前日期時間在後臺連續不斷,以便我們可以發送提醒給用戶。

下面是我的示例模型。 models.py

class BirthDayModel(models.Model): 
    name=models.CharField(max_length=30) 
    birthdate=models.DateTimeField() 
    user = models.ForeignKey(settings.AUTH_USER_MODEL, default=1) 
    timestamp=models.DateTimeField(auto_now_add=True) 

請對此建議。 謝謝

回答

0

你應該嘗試像服務的cron定期檢查背景。其他不錯的選擇是Django芹菜和apscheduler。而且,如果你有使用Django頻道的websocket,請嘗試beatserver

相關問題